Sorry, basic question here, how does the WWE know which stars are "main event worthy" and which feuds are working? Is it ratings? Internet chatter? Crowd reactions? I don't get how they evaluate these things, especially so quickly. All 3, crowd reaction plays a big role though. And they don't always get it right. There have been tons of people who they've tried to pass off as main event worthy (Kozlov, Lashley) and have failed...Meanwhile, others (like Jeff Hardy and Eddie Guerrero) can languish around the upper mid card for years with strong reactions and they before they pull the trigger and give them a chance. |
